The Advantages of Buying a Classic Car

One of the biggest advantages of buying a classic car is the sense of nostalgia that comes with it. These cars have a rich history and have been preserved for decades, making them a valuable piece of history. Owning a classic car is not just about owning a vehicle; it’s about owning a piece of history that you can cherish for years to come.

Another advantage of owning a classic car is the uniqueness factor. These cars are not mass-produced like modern cars, which makes them stand out on the road. You will never have to worry about someone driving the same car as you, which is a common occurrence with modern cars.

Additionally, owning a classic car is an investment. These cars hold their value and can even appreciate over time if they are well-maintained. In some cases, they can even be worth more than what you paid for them when you decide to sell.

However, there are also some disadvantages to owning a classic car. Maintenance and repair costs can be high, and finding replacement parts can be a challenge. Classic cars also do not have the same safety features as modern cars, which can be a concern for some buyers.

What to Look for When Buying a Classic Car

When buying a classic car, it’s essential to do your research and know what you’re looking for. Here are some things to keep in mind:

1. Condition: The condition of the car is one of the most important factors to consider. Look for rust, cracks, and signs of wear and tear. If the car has been restored, make sure it was done correctly.

2. Authenticity: Make sure the car is authentic and has not been modified or altered too much. Verify the car’s VIN number and check for documentation, such as the original bill of sale and maintenance records.

3. Price: Classic cars can be expensive, so make sure you are getting a fair price. Research the market value of the car you are interested in and compare prices from different dealers or private sellers.

4. Test Drive: Always take the car for a test drive before buying it. This will give you a feel for how the car handles and if there are any issues that need to be addressed.

5. Insurance: Classic cars require specialty insurance, so make sure you have a policy in place before purchasing one.

The Best Places to Find Classic Cars in Philadelphia

Philadelphia has a thriving car culture, and there are several places you can find classic cars for sale. Here are some of the best:

1. Boyd’s Philadelphia: Boyd’s is a classic car dealership that specializes in vintage and exotic cars. They have a wide selection of classic cars, including muscle cars, antique cars, and pre-war cars.

2. Gateway Classic Cars: Gateway Classic Cars is a nationwide dealership that has a location in West Deptford, just outside of Philadelphia. They have a vast inventory of classic cars, including hot rods, muscle cars, and exotics.

3. The Simeone Foundation Automotive Museum: The Simeone Foundation Automotive Museum is a car museum located in Philadelphia that features a collection of over 65 classic race cars. While they do not sell cars, they offer a unique opportunity to see some of the most iconic cars in history.

Classic Car Shows and Events in Philadelphia

Philadelphia is home to several classic car shows and events throughout the year. These events are an excellent opportunity to see some of the most iconic cars in history and meet other car enthusiasts. Here are some of the best:

1. Das Awkscht Fescht: Das Awkscht Fescht is an annual car show held in Macungie, just outside of Philadelphia. It features over 3,000 classic cars, trucks, and motorcycles from all over the country.

2. The Philadelphia Auto Show: The Philadelphia Auto Show is an annual event that showcases the latest cars and technology from the world’s leading automotive manufacturers. While not exclusively a classic car show, it does feature a classic car section.

3. The Stotesbury Cup Regatta: The Stotesbury Cup Regatta is an annual rowing competition held on the Schuylkill River in Philadelphia. While not a classic car show, it features a classic car parade before the races begin.
